Mental Healthcare Act 2017 and Its Impact on Startups and Small Businesses

Image
Much discussion of the Mental Healthcare Act 2017 focuses on large enterprises with dedicated HR and legal functions capable of navigating complex compliance requirements. Startups and small businesses, often operating with limited HR infrastructure, face genuine questions about how this legislation applies to their specific, more resource-constrained context. Why This Legislation Matters Even for Very Small Organisations Legal Obligations Apply Regardless of Company Size The Act's non-discrimination provisions apply to employers broadly, without exemption based on organisational size — meaning even a five-person startup carries the same fundamental legal obligation to avoid discriminating against employees based on mental illness as a large enterprise. Mental Health First Aid Training for NGO Leadership, Not Just Frontline Staff

Image
Discussions of mental health support within the social sector often focus heavily on frontline workers directly engaging with vulnerable populations. Equally important, though less frequently addressed, is recognising that NGO Worker and Volunteer Needs Mental Health First Aid Training applies just as significantly to organisational leadership, whose decisions and behaviour shape the entire organisation's approach to this issue. Why Leadership Training Deserves Distinct Attention Leadership Sets the Organisational Tone Whether frontline staff feel genuinely safe disclosing struggles or accessing available support depends heavily on visible leadership behaviour and priority-setting — meaning leadership's own understanding and modelling of mental health support directly shapes organisational culture around this issue.
